Author: sohil.shah(a)jboss.com
Date: 2009-01-26 11:28:32 -0500 (Mon, 26 Jan 2009)
New Revision: 12640
Modified:
modules/identity/trunk/build/pom.xml
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/cas/CASAuthenticationService.java
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/josso/JOSSOIdentityServiceImpl.java
Log:
* fix the logic bug pointed to by the security team
* changing common dependency from snaphost to 1.2.0. module fails to compile without it
Modified: modules/identity/trunk/build/pom.xml
===================================================================
--- modules/identity/trunk/build/pom.xml 2009-01-26 15:56:19 UTC (rev 12639)
+++ modules/identity/trunk/build/pom.xml 2009-01-26 16:28:32 UTC (rev 12640)
@@ -28,8 +28,8 @@
<version.junit>3.8.1</version.junit>
<version.cargo>0.9-portal</version.cargo>
<version.ant>1.6.5</version.ant>
-
<version.jboss.portal.common>1.2.0-SNAPSHOT</version.jboss.portal.common>
- <version.jboss.portal.test>1.2.0.Beta2</version.jboss.portal.test>
+ <version.jboss.portal.common>1.2.0</version.jboss.portal.common>
+ <version.jboss.portal.test>1.2.1</version.jboss.portal.test>
<version.jboss.microcontainer>2.0.0.Beta9</version.jboss.microcontainer>
<version.sun.opends>1.0.0-BUILD04</version.sun.opends>
<version.jboss.jbossas.core-libs>4.0.4.GA</version.jboss.jbossas.core-libs>
Modified:
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/cas/CASAuthenticationService.java
===================================================================
---
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/cas/CASAuthenticationService.java 2009-01-26
15:56:19 UTC (rev 12639)
+++
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/cas/CASAuthenticationService.java 2009-01-26
16:28:32 UTC (rev 12640)
@@ -126,7 +126,7 @@
{
//Check and make sure the user account is enabled
Boolean enabled = (Boolean)this.profileModule.getProperty(user,
User.INFO_USER_ENABLED);
- if(enabled != null || enabled.booleanValue())
+ if(enabled != null && enabled.booleanValue())
{
//Check and make sure user has proper role setup
if(this.havingRole != null &&
this.havingRole.trim().length()>0)
Modified:
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/josso/JOSSOIdentityServiceImpl.java
===================================================================
---
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/josso/JOSSOIdentityServiceImpl.java 2009-01-26
15:56:19 UTC (rev 12639)
+++
modules/identity/trunk/sso/src/main/java/org/jboss/portal/identity/sso/josso/JOSSOIdentityServiceImpl.java 2009-01-26
16:28:32 UTC (rev 12640)
@@ -190,7 +190,7 @@
{
//Check and make sure the user account is enabled
Boolean enabled = (Boolean)this.profileModule.getProperty(user,
User.INFO_USER_ENABLED);
- if(enabled != null || enabled.booleanValue())
+ if(enabled != null && enabled.booleanValue())
{
//Now perform validation
status = user.validatePassword(password);
Show replies by date